Runbook, Step 5 — Websocket compression on the Quillhatch gateway. We're shipping permessage-deflate enabled by default, which cuts bandwidth ~60% but opens the usual compression-oracle concerns, so we disable it on any channel carrying session tokens. Security reviewers: please confirm the channel allowlist before sign-off. Once you're happy, the gateway build gets signed and pushed to the Bellreach fleet. Signing happens with the release key shown below.

release key, yafog-kadug: bky13_ADqM5YQWZutLX

Subject: Welcome to Shorelight on-call

Hi, and welcome to the rotation. The Shorelight tide-table widget pulls predictions from the Moonharbor calculation service, caches them for six hours, and renders through the plugin layer you all build against. Most pages come from stale caches after a Moonharbor deploy, or from plugins requesting stations outside the supported basin list. Please don't clear the cache globally; there's a per-station flush that's much safer. The escalation tree, flush procedure, and plugin troubleshooting notes are here.

operations page: https://superset.halixsoft.internal/run

## Artifact Signing — DedupeHorn

DedupeHorn is our on-call alert deduplicator; because it sits in the paging path, every build artifact must be signed before the scheduler will load it. Unsigned bundles are silently dropped, which looks like missed alerts — a dangerous failure mode. Signing happens in the `forge-sign` stage; verify the checksum manifest first. New team members should register the signing key shown below.

deploy key for kajof-fajop: bky6_gDHw9Q